Combat Burnout: Support and Treatment

Burnout is a common problem that can affect anyone. It's characterized by feelings of exhaustion, cynicism, and a lack sense of accomplishment. If you're feeling overwhelmed and unable to manage, it's important to request support and treatment.

There are many resources available to help you navigate burnout. Firstly, talk to your healthcare provider. They can help rule out any underlying medical conditions that may be contributing to your Accelerated Resolution Therapy (ART) symptoms and can suggest treatment options.

In addition to medical treatment, consider these approaches to manage burnout:

* Focus on self-care activities like movement.

* Establish healthy boundaries at work and in your daily life.

* Cultivate mindfulness or meditation to reduce stress.

* Connect relationships with friends.

Remember, burnout is not a sign of weakness. It's a common response to pressure. By accepting support and implementing healthy coping mechanisms, you can recover.
